A general solution for the thermal constriction resistance due to a flux applied over a circular portion of the upper surface of a compound disk is presented. The disk consists of two layers having different conductivities. Heat flow to a prescribed outer edge temperature and/or through a film coefficient over the lower surface to an ambient temperature is considered. The solution is derived with due consideration given to the compatibility required at the interface between the two materials. The results are presented in analytic form and encompass a wide variety of thermal and geometric parameters. (DePo)
